What Features Should You Look for in the Best Commercial Juicer for a Juice Bar?

When selecting the best commercial juicer for a juice bar, several key features should be considered to ensure efficiency and quality juice production.

  • Juicing Method: The type of juicing method, such as centrifugal or masticating, plays a crucial role in the quality of juice produced. Centrifugal juicers are faster but may generate heat, affecting juice nutrients, while masticating juicers operate slower, preserving more vitamins and enzymes for a higher-quality product.
  • Durability: A commercial juicer must be built to withstand heavy use, so materials such as stainless steel or high-quality plastic should be prioritized. Look for models with a solid warranty and positive reviews regarding longevity and ease of maintenance.
  • Ease of Cleaning: A juicer that is easy to disassemble and clean will save valuable time in a busy juice bar setting. Features like dishwasher-safe parts and smooth surfaces that prevent juice buildup are essential for maintaining hygiene and efficiency.
  • Yield Efficiency: The juicer’s ability to extract maximum juice from fruits and vegetables is important for profitability. Models that boast high yield efficiency ensure that you get more juice from the same amount of produce, reducing waste and cost.
  • Noise Level: In a juice bar, excessive noise can be disruptive to customers. Select a juicer known for quieter operation, allowing for a pleasant atmosphere while still delivering high performance.
  • Size and Footprint: Depending on the layout of your juice bar, the size of the juicer can be a significant factor. Ensure that the juicer fits well in your workspace without compromising other operational areas; compact designs may be beneficial in smaller setups.
  • Versatility: A juicer that can handle a variety of produce, including leafy greens, hard fruits, and even nut milks, will provide more options for your menu. Versatile machines can cater to diverse customer preferences and expand your offerings.
  • Speed of Operation: The speed at which a juicer can process fruits and vegetables can significantly affect service time during peak hours. Look for models that combine speed with quality to keep up with customer demand without sacrificing the juice’s nutritional value.

What Types of Commercial Juicers Are Best for Juice Bars?

The best commercial juicers for juice bars typically include the following types:

  • Centrifugal Juicers: These juicers use high-speed blades to shred fruits and vegetables, extracting juice quickly.
  • Masticating Juicers: Also known as cold press juicers, they operate at a slower speed, crushing and squeezing produce to maximize juice yield.
  • Hydraulic Press Juicers: These are used to extract juice from softer fruits and leafy greens by applying high pressure, effectively maximizing the amount of juice extracted.
  • Twin Gear Juicers: These juicers feature two interlocking gears that crush and grind produce, offering a high juice yield and retaining more nutrients.
  • Commercial Citrus Juicers: Specifically designed for citrus fruits, these juicers are efficient for making fresh orange, lemon, and lime juices.

Centrifugal Juicers: Centrifugal juicers are popular for their speed, making them ideal for high-volume juice bars where quick service is essential. They can handle hard fruits and vegetables well but may produce more foam and oxidation, potentially affecting juice quality over time.

Masticating Juicers: Masticating juicers are favored for their ability to extract juice with minimal oxidation, preserving nutrients and flavor. Their slower operation allows for juicing leafy greens and soft fruits effectively, making them versatile for diverse juice recipes.

Hydraulic Press Juicers: Hydraulic press juicers are known for their efficiency in extracting juice from leafy greens and soft fruits, yielding high-quality juice with a rich flavor. They are generally more expensive and require more space, but they are excellent for juice bars focusing on high-end, nutrient-dense juices.

Twin Gear Juicers: Twin gear juicers offer a dual-stage juicing process, which maximizes juice extraction and nutritional retention. They are particularly effective for a variety of produce, including wheatgrass, making them a great choice for juice bars offering specialized health-focused options.

Commercial Citrus Juicers: Commercial citrus juicers are designed specifically for juicing citrus fruits, making them ideal for juice bars that focus heavily on fresh orange or lemon juices. They are typically easy to operate and clean, providing a steady output of juice, which is crucial during peak hours.

How Do Centrifugal Juicers Work for Juice Bars?

Centrifugal juicers are popular in juice bars due to their speed and efficiency in extracting juice from fruits and vegetables.

  • Motor and Blade System: Centrifugal juicers feature a powerful motor that spins a sharp blade at high speeds, typically between 6,000 and 14,000 RPM. This spinning action grates the produce into tiny pieces, allowing the juice to be extracted quickly.
  • Juice Extraction Process: As the blade spins, the produce is pushed against a mesh filter, which separates the juice from the pulp. The centrifugal force generated by the high-speed rotation helps to propel the juice through the filter, making the extraction process efficient.
  • Pulp Collection: The leftover pulp is ejected into a separate container, allowing for continuous juicing without the need for frequent interruptions to empty the pulp. This is particularly beneficial in a busy juice bar setting where speed is essential.
  • Ease of Use and Cleaning: Centrifugal juicers are generally easy to operate, often featuring wide feed chutes that can accommodate whole fruits and vegetables. Most models also come apart easily, making them straightforward to clean, which is vital for maintaining hygiene in a commercial environment.
  • Juice Quality: While centrifugal juicers are fast, they may produce juice with a shorter shelf life due to exposure to heat and air during the extraction process. This is an important consideration for juice bars that prioritize freshness and nutrient retention in their offerings.

What Are the Advantages of Using Masticating Juicers in a Juice Bar?

The advantages of using masticating juicers in a juice bar include higher juice yield, better nutrient retention, and versatility in processing various ingredients.

  • Higher Juice Yield: Masticating juicers extract juice by crushing and pressing fruits and vegetables, resulting in a greater yield compared to centrifugal juicers. This means that juice bars can maximize their ingredient usage, reducing waste and increasing profitability.
  • Better Nutrient Retention: The slow extraction process of masticating juicers minimizes heat and oxidation, preserving essential vitamins, minerals, and enzymes in the juice. This ensures that customers receive a product that is not only delicious but also packed with health benefits.
  • Versatility: Masticating juicers can handle a wide variety of ingredients, including leafy greens, hard vegetables, and even nuts for nut milks. This versatility allows juice bars to expand their menu offerings, catering to different dietary preferences and trends.
  • Longer Shelf Life: The juice produced by masticating juicers tends to have a longer shelf life due to reduced oxidation. This is particularly beneficial for juice bars looking to prepare juices in advance without compromising on quality.
  • Quieter Operation: Masticating juicers operate at a lower RPM, which results in a quieter performance compared to their centrifugal counterparts. This makes for a more pleasant environment in busy juice bars, allowing staff and customers to communicate easily.
  • Easy Cleaning: Many masticating juicers are designed with fewer parts and offer easy disassembly, which simplifies the cleaning process. This is a significant advantage in a juice bar setting where efficiency and hygiene are paramount.

How Can You Determine the Price Range for Commercial Juicers?

Determining the price range for commercial juicers involves considering several factors that influence costs. Here are key elements to evaluate:

  • Type of Juicer: Centrifugal juicers typically cost less than masticating or cold-press juicers. The latter often command higher prices due to their ability to extract juice more efficiently and preserve nutrients.

  • Brand and Reputation: Established brands with a solid track record for durability and performance tend to have higher prices. Investing in reputable brands may offer long-term savings through reliability and after-sales service.

  • Features and Capabilities: Juicers that come with additional features such as multiple speed settings, larger feed chutes, or specialized attachments can increase the price. Assessing the specific needs of your juice bar will help determine which features are essential.

  • Material Quality: Stainless steel constructions are generally more expensive than plastic ones but offer improved longevity and hygiene—important factors for a commercial environment.

  • Warranty and Support: Models with extended warranties or excellent customer support may come at a premium but can provide peace of mind and reduce future replacement costs.

Prices for commercial juicers can range from around $200 for basic models to over $5,000 for high-end machines, depending on these factors.

What Maintenance Do Commercial Juicers Need to Stay in Top Shape?

Proper maintenance is essential for ensuring that commercial juicers perform optimally and last longer, especially in a busy juice bar environment.

  • Regular Cleaning: It is crucial to clean the juicer after each use to prevent residue buildup and maintain hygiene. This involves disassembling the parts, washing them with warm soapy water, and ensuring all components are dried thoroughly to avoid rust and bacterial growth.
  • Blade and Filter Inspection: Regularly checking the sharpness of the blades and the condition of the filters is necessary for optimal juice extraction. Dull blades can lead to inefficient processing and increased strain on the motor, while clogged filters may reduce juice quality and flow.
  • Motor Maintenance: Keeping the motor in good condition is vital for the juicer’s performance. This includes checking for any unusual sounds during operation, ensuring proper lubrication if applicable, and scheduling professional servicing to address any electrical issues.
  • Replacement of Worn Parts: Over time, certain parts such as seals, gaskets, and blades may wear out and need replacement. Regularly inspecting these components can help prevent leaks and ensure the juicer operates at peak efficiency.
  • Calibration and Adjustments: Periodically calibrating the juicer can ensure it is functioning correctly and producing consistent juice quality. Adjustments may be needed based on the type of produce being juiced and the desired consistency of the final product.
  • Proper Storage: When not in use, the juicer should be stored in a clean, dry environment to prevent dust accumulation and potential damage. Covering the juicer can also protect it from environmental factors that might affect its performance.
